It seems that the keywords you are trying to use on other pages may not be detected due to a few possible reasons:
-
SEO Settings: Ensure that you have properly configured the SEO settings for each page where you want the keywords to be detected. You can do this by navigating to the Rank Math Metabox on each page and entering your focus keywords there.
-
Content Analysis: Rank Math analyzes the content of each page to detect keywords. If the keywords are not present in the content or if they are not used effectively, they may not be detected. Make sure that the keywords are naturally integrated into the content, headings, and meta descriptions of those pages.
-
Static Page Settings: If your homepage is set as a static page, ensure that you have also set up SEO titles and descriptions for other pages in the same way you did for the homepage. You can do this under Rank Math > Titles & Meta for each specific page.
